What Are Electrolytes?

Electrolytes are essential minerals that play a crucial role in keeping our bodies functioning at their best. Sodium

Sodium is essential in an electrolyte mix for maintaining fluid balance and muscle function. It’s lost through sweat during exercise, so replenishing sodium helps prevent dehydration, cramps, and fatigue, supporting both performance and recovery.

Potassium

Often hailed as a key player in muscle function, potassium helps regulate muscle contractions and supports heart health. It’s also vital for maintaining proper fluid balance in cells and helps work alongside sodium, promoting healthy blood pressure levels.

Magnesium

The relaxation mineral — magnesium is involved in over 300 biochemical reactions in the body. It helps with energy production, muscle relaxation, and recovery, making it essential for active individuals. Magnesium also plays a role in maintaining normal nerve function.

Drinking More Water
Is Enough for
Hydration

Drinking water is important, but it’s not the whole picture. Proper hydration also requires electrolytes like sodium, potassium, and magnesium to help your body retain and balance fluids. Without these electrolytes, you may still experience symptoms of dehydration, such as fatigue and muscle cramps, even if you’re drinking plenty of water. To stay truly hydrated, it's about balancing both water and electrolytes.
